Let's face it: Twitch roles are totally broken. So getting straight to the point, here are how i think roles should be, and what roles we need. Starting with existing roles:
-VIP-
Nothing really needs change.
-Artist-
Can change emotes. Nothing crazy lol.
-Editors-
They are WAAAAY too overpowered, i think they should merge with other roles, they can literally change your entire stream info, play ads, it's ridiculous, but i think they should also have their own role, they can still change the title / category etc. but they can't do the any of the advanced stuff (ads, no raids, etc.)
-Moderators-
Now here's my first point: mods are kinda underpowered, only a bit, i think they should be able to disable raids (Like editor) cause it kinda counts as moderation (Hate raiding for example) and VIP / UNVIP and MOD / UNMOD commands should be removed (Another role can) and a Shadowban command should be added. Last thing: Can delete clips (Cause it's viewer made, so moderation can help)
Now we have existing roles out of the way, let's go on my new role ideas, and speaking of new roles, we should be able to add roles for your channel i mean it's common sense lol.
-Admin-
The big role, the absolute, a admin is basically a mod + editor. Admins can do anything that a mod and editor can do, WITHOUT the restrictions i mentioned for the mod, same for editor.
That's really it lol, so here's all the roles: Admin, Artist, Editor, Moderator, VIP. Thanks for reading!
